    The Last Lesson by Alphonse Daudet SUMMARY The Last Lesson is a story set in Alsace‚ a territory that was disputed over by France and Germany. At the time of the story France was defeated by Prussia led by Bismarck. The French districts of Alsace and Lorraine had passed into Prussian hands. An order had come from Berlin that only German was to be taught in the schools of these districts. the author‚ Alphonse Daudet‚ brings out the effect of this order on the people of Alsace through this story
